Q: How much to retain an attorney or a level 2 felony meth charge with 2 priors

A: Attorneys will not generally quote fees in public forums like this. I suggest you contact me or other attorneys privately through this site. For one thing, in order to quote a fee, an attorney would need to discuss the facts of your case, and you definitely do not want to do that publicly!

A: It will likely be quite a bit of money, but without knowing more details/facts of the case, it is difficult to quote based on simply the charges. However, do not put any personal information or specifics about your case on a public forum such as this because it may be monitored by police or prosecutors. Call several attorneys to discuss your case and payment options then go with the one you are most comfortable with in representing you.
